The last sprint race of the 2023-2024 Cross-Country Skiing World Cup takes place. We compete in classic technique in Falun: today 58 women and 79 men battle for the last time on the shortest distance on the calendar.
Four Italians are at the start in the latter context, while only Nicole Monsorno is on stage in the women’s context. The fate of the two World Cups will be decided this weekend. Harald Oestberg Amundsen, to defend himself from Klaebo’s return, must reach 2604 points, i.e. gaining 189 in the last races. On the other hand, in the women’s Jessie Diggins has 102 points over Linn Svahn: a USA-Sweden duel that seems a little more uncertain for various reasons, and which could indeed drag on until the last race.
